Scenario: You are the newly assigned project manager in charge of a major software
migration, which will require the updating of more that 7000 laptops across the
employees in five states. Due to unique circumstances regarding this particular
migration, a technician will need to visit each machine, configure settings, download and
install updates, and run a series of validation exercises to confirm a successful
migrations. One of the first things you will need to do is identify team members.
Brainstorm the key skills that you will want in the members of this team. - Answer Key
skills might include familiarity with the software to be migrated, experience migrating
software solutions, customer service skills, the ability to create and execute a playbook
to carry out a consistent process, the ability to maintain records and document actions,
and troubleshooting skills.

Scenario: You are the newly assigned project manager in charge of a major software
migration, which will require the updating of more that 7000 laptops across the
employees in five states. Due to unique circumstances regarding this particular
migration, a technician will need to visit each machine, configure settings, download and
install updates, and run a series of validation exercises to confirm a successful
migrations. One of the first things you will need to do is identify team members. You will
want to be able to validate that a proposed team member has the key skills you are
looking for. You wish to establish a resource schedule for the project. What types of
information should you include? - Answer Information might include how resources will
be identified and acquired; the roles and responsibilities; the needed competencies;
organization charts; training strategies and requirements; team development method to
be used; and resource controls for the management of physical resources to support
the team. Also, project team resource management, including the guidance on the
lifecycle of the team resources-how they are defined, staffed, managed, and eventually
released. And, finally a recognition plan detailing how team members are rewarded and
recognized.
Scenario: You are forming the team for migration project, and you want to help the team
begin working through establishing its norms and defining how they will work together to
, accomplish the project objectives. You organize and initial team meeting. The team
decides it should produce a team charter, but is unsure of exactly what it should cover.
What are some the key areas that good team charter should include? - Answer The
team should identify at least some of the following key items: shared values, guidelines
for communication, use of collaboration tools, decision making approach, conflict
management, when the team meets, shared hours, how the team improves.

Scenario: You have been asked to help negotiate terms and conditions for creating a
website for a client. While they have outlined a few of the basic needs of the project,
they have yet to formalize any of the core deliverables. The client has a long list of
requirements, and you wish to help them prioritize their needs to help identify a
Minimum Viable Product and to provide a basis for organizing the work in a backlog.
What are some of the techniques you could use to help them? - Answer Kano Model,
Moscow (MSCW) Analysis, Paired Comparison, or 100-Point Method.
